Frequently asked questions

What is the land area of the property at 57 John Farrant Drive?

The property sits on approximately 10,701 square metres of land.

How far is the property from Gooseberry Hill National Park?

Gooseberry Hill National Park is about 1.1 km away, making it within easy walking distance.

Which public transport routes serve the Gooseberry Hill area?

Bus routes 274, 275, 276 and 307 operate through Gooseberry Hill, linking the suburb to Kalamunda Bus Station, High Wycombe Station and Midland Station.

What historic or natural landmarks are located near the property?

Nearby landmarks include Zig Zag Scenic Drive (≈0.9 km), the historic Kalamunda Zig Zag railway formation (≈1.0 km), Statham's Quarry (≈1.5 km) and Gooseberry Hill mountain (≈1.3 km).

What is the significance of the name “Gooseberry Hill”?

The name comes from the cape gooseberries that grew in the area, a name recorded by surveyor Henry Samuel Ranford in 1878.

Are there any notable historical events associated with Gooseberry Hill?

In April 1945 a US Navy C‑47 aircraft crashed in heavy fog near Gooseberry Hill, resulting in the loss of all aboard.

Which major road provides access to the property?

Kalamunda Road lies roughly 1.8 km from the property, offering a main thoroughfare to surrounding suburbs.
